Crane Inspection Training for Overhead and Underhung Configurations
This popular crane inspection course covers a wide variety of overhead and underhung crane configurations. Participants receive a working knowledge of all pertinent regulatory agency requirements. Attendees may participate in an optional written evaluation following the seminar. Those who successfully pass the written evaluation will be issued a wallet-size Crane Inspection card with photo, valid for 2 years. There is no additional charge for this testing and card.
Who should attend:
Crane maintenance personnel, electricians, mechanics, mill wrights, inspectors, maintenance supervisors, foremen, facilities engineers, or anyone else connected with your maintenance or safety program.
Course objectives
- Perform inspections in accordance with all pertinent codes and regulations
- Understand and interpret applicable sections of OSHA Title 29 regulations (OSHA 29CFR)
- Have a working knowledge of ANSI/ASME Standard B30
- Recognize and perform required record keeping
- Be able to perform consistent, comprehensive crane inspections
Course outline
- Crane types and service classifications
- General inspection requirements
- General crane safety and housekeeping
- Hazards / shutdown conditions
- Runways, wheels, and brakes
- Crane structure and electrical systems
- Drive machinery and hoist equipment
